Sat 1925018688812663

decimal
770029.563812663
degree
0°140029′1933″563812663‴
percentile
91.66755671096116%
name
afewzxouifa
cycle
0
epoch
3
period
381
block
770029
offset
563812663
timestamp
rarity
common